Iowa considered to be one of the first 'divorce mills in the United States says Northern Iowa professor.

Article Summary
Glenda Riley says Iowa was one of the first 'divorce mills' in the 1840s and 1850s because it had such liberal laws on divorce, family and women. People from all over the country came to Iowa to get a divorce.
